Understanding the Role of NEMT in Senior Care

When we talk about a "care plan," we aren't just talking about pills and checkups. We’re talking about a holistic approach to living well. For many seniors in Northern California, mobility is the primary barrier to that "well-living."

Professional NEMT (Non-Emergency Medical Transportation) is specifically designed for individuals who don't need an ambulance but do need more assistance than a standard taxi or Uber can provide. Whether your loved one uses a wheelchair or simply needs a steady arm to lean on, NEMT providers bridge the gap between home and the healthcare facility.

By building NEMT in Sacramento and Placer County into your weekly schedule, you ensure that medical consistency isn't dependent on your personal availability. It moves transportation from a "stressful variable" to a "reliable constant."

Step 1: Auditing the Weekly Schedule

The first step to successful integration is looking at the calendar. A typical care plan in Placer County might look like this:

  • Monday: Dialysis in Sacramento.

  • Wednesday: Physical therapy in Roseville.

  • Friday: A standing cardiology appointment or a social visit to a senior center in Auburn.

When you look at these recurring needs, you realize that booking rides one-by-one is exhausting. We recommend identifying the "anchor appointments": the ones that happen every week without fail. These are the perfect candidates for a recurring NEMT schedule.

Step 2: Choosing Door-Through-Door Over Curb-to-Curb

One of the biggest mistakes families make is choosing a transportation service that only offers "curb-to-curb" delivery. For a senior with cognitive decline or physical mobility issues, being dropped off at the curb of a massive medical complex in Sacramento is terrifying.

At Golden Age Transportation LLC, we specialize in door-through-door service. This means we don’t just stop the van and wait for them to get out. We assist them out of their home, secure them safely in our specialized vehicles, and: most importantly: we walk them into the clinic and ensure they are checked in at the front desk.

This level of care is a game-changer for families. You don't have to wonder if Mom made it to her floor or if Dad is sitting in the lobby lost. Step 3: Coordinating with Your NEMT Provider

Once you’ve identified your needs, it’s time to sync up. When integrating with Golden Age Transportation LLC, we recommend a quick introductory call to discuss specific needs:

  • Does the rider use a standard or oversized wheelchair?

  • Do they have specific cognitive needs (like dementia or Alzheimer’s) that require extra patience and a familiar face?

  • What are the exact check-in procedures for their facility?

By providing this info upfront, we can match your loved one with a consistent driver. Familiarity breeds comfort, and for many of our clients in Placerville and Sutter Creek, seeing the same friendly face every Tuesday makes the trip something to look forward to, rather than something to fear.

Why Rideshare Isn't a Care Plan Solution

It’s tempting to pull out an app and call a quick ride. It’s cheap, and it’s fast: until it isn't. Rideshare drivers are not trained in patient transfer, they don’t understand the nuances of wheelchair securement, and they certainly won't walk your loved one into a doctor's office.

Furthermore, rideshare reliability in more rural parts of Placer and Amador Counties can be spotty at best. If a driver cancels five minutes before a critical dialysis appointment, the entire care plan for the week is thrown into chaos.

Professional NEMT offers "Reliability You Can Lean On." We are a scheduled service, meaning your slot is blocked out and guaranteed. For those managing chronic conditions, missing even one session can have health consequences. Maintaining Independence Beyond the Doctor’s Office

A great care plan shouldn't just be about survival; it should be about thriving. We often work with families in El Dorado Hills and Lincoln to provide transport for "non-medical" medical needs. This might include:

  • Trips to the pharmacy to pick up life-saving medications.

  • Visits to a specialized grocery store for dietary-restricted foods.

  • Attending family gatherings or religious services.

Integrating NEMT into these "lifestyle" activities helps seniors maintain their sense of self. It prevents the isolation that so often leads to depression in the elderly. When a senior knows they have a reliable way to get around, they are more likely to stay active and engaged with their community.
